Alright, new ranges with new darts.

The new darts helped, but I definitely need 6" barrels on this thing, I was getting wicked tail wagging on these shots. At least they went straight though.

Ranges, 10 Pumps, 20 Shots per Dart Type, Flat Shot, Rounded down to the nearest foot:

Double BB 2" Stefans:
68, 68, 67, 65, 62, 62, 60, 60, 57, 56, 55, 54, 53, 53, 53, 52, 50, 50, 46, 44

Average: 56.75'

1/4" Steel Slingshot Ball 2" Stefans:
75, 71, 69, 66, 66, 65, 65, 65, 65, 65, 64, 64, 63, 62, 62, 61, 58, 56, 56, 54

Average: 63.60'

So the 1/4" balls definitely improved the range quite a bit, I'm going to strip this thing down and put 6" barrels on it to see how much that helps, I'm also going to use liquid nails to secure and seal the barrels instead of hotglue, so that should help too.

I'll edit with a couple of pictures later.

From my experience, both had trigger issues, I needed to rebuild the LBB trigger within 50 shots out of the box, the BBBB needs to have a reinforced trigger if you plan on plugging the pump. The BBBB's valve dumps air MUCH faster than the LBB one, but it can get hard to pull at higher numbers of pumps, the LBB valve feels the same from 0-30 pumps.

I can attest that the BBBB trigger is extremely difficult to pull at 12 pumps, and after that you need a wrench to get the thing to dump all at once instead of pissing out the air slowly till the pressure drops far enough.

The trigger mech I describe in the guide here works perfectly for about 10-11 pumps, and has issues with 12. I'll be adding a block to the trigger to correct this, but for now 10 pumps is about perfect.
